How Long Do Magic Mushroom Chocolates Last?
Psilocybin is powerful, but it is not immortal. The way you store your magic mushroom chocolate determines whether it delivers clarity or confusion. Here is what you need to know about the true lifespan of your sacred stash.
Short-Term: Room Temperature
If you are storing your chocolate in a dark drawer or a cool cabinet, it can stay stable for up to six months. The sweet spot is between 60 and 70 degrees Fahrenheit. Anything warmer and the magic begins to fade faster.
After about three months, you may notice a gentle dip in potency. By six months, you could be missing up to a third of the intended effect.
Mid-Term: Refrigeration
Refrigeration helps keep the power intact. When properly sealed, your magic mushroom chocolate can hold strong for six to twelve months in the fridge. This method retains up to 85 percent of the potency, while also protecting texture and flavor. Just be sure the container is airtight. Moisture is not your friend.
Long-Term: Freezing
For those storing in bulk or planning for the long game, freezing is the safest path. Vacuum sealing and freezing your chocolate extends its life to eighteen months. When thawing, always move it to the fridge first. Sudden temperature shifts can damage both form and function.
Key Shelf Life Guidelines
- Room temperature storage: Lasts 3 to 6 months at 60 to 70°F
- Refrigerated storage: Lasts 6 to 12 months in an airtight container
- Frozen storage: Lasts 12 to 18 months if vacuum sealed and thawed slowly

Ingredient Integrity
Not all ingredients age gracefully. Add-ins like fruit, nuts, or dairy can spoil long before the chocolate or the mushroom loses potency. That decay shortens the lifespan of your medicine and risks altering its energy.
We craft our bars with organic, full-spectrum inputs and avoid synthetics entirely. This not only honors the spirit of the fungi, it ensures each bar remains stable for longer stretches of time.
Chocolate Type Matters
Dark chocolate is more than a taste choice. It holds up better over time than milk or white varieties. Lower dairy content means less moisture and fewer variables to manage during storage.
Our ceremonial blends are made from antioxidant-rich cacao with low moisture content. That means they resist degradation while delivering deeper nourishment to body and mind.
Packaging Rituals
The outer layer is just as sacred as what is inside. Packaging acts as a guardian against air, moisture, light, and time itself. Thoughtful containment is part of the medicine.
Core Packaging Principles
- Vacuum-sealing: Removes oxygen that accelerates degradation
- Foil-lining: Shields against light and air
- Desiccants: Help absorb ambient moisture
- Airtight jars: Add a second layer of defense

Light, Air and Heat Are the Enemy
These three elements quietly dismantle potency if left unchecked. Psilocybin is fragile. It responds quickly to its environment.
- UV light: Breaks down the active compound and weakens the energetic profile
- Air exposure: Causes oxidation that dulls both taste and effect
- Heat: Warps distribution, melts structure, and alters consistency
Recommended Storage Setups
Choose setups that support sacred protection. A wine cooler offers a stable, low-light environment ideal for preserving potency. A desktop humidor regulates both airflow and moisture with quiet precision. Airtight glass jars with desiccants keep freshness sealed in and unwanted elements out.

Can mushroom powder expand or shift in chocolate over time?
Yes. If the chocolate is not tempered properly or stored in fluctuating temperatures, the mushroom powder can separate or settle.
This leads to inconsistent dosing, where one square may be far more potent than another. It is why we emphasize even mixing during preparation and stable storage after.
Does freezing ruin the magic?
Not if done with care. Freezing actually preserves potency better than any other method. But the thawing process must be gradual.
If taken straight from the freezer to room temperature, condensation can form, damaging texture and distribution. Always thaw in the refrigerator to avoid moisture shock.
How do I stop bloom from forming in the fridge?
Bloom is that white or grayish haze that can appear on chocolate. It comes from cocoa butter separating due to moisture or heat changes. While it is harmless, it signals poor storage.
Keep chocolate in an airtight container and allow it to cool or warm slowly between environments to avoid bloom.
Will my mold affect chocolate volume?
Yes. The volume of mushroom powder you add will slightly shift how much chocolate fits in each mold. If you are working with precise doses, you will need to adjust accordingly.
Always account for the added mushroom weight in your total mixture to maintain accuracy. Precision begins with planning.
How to Tell If Your Magic Mushroom Chocolate Has Gone Bad
Not all chocolate lasts forever. Even sacred medicine has a shelf life. When stored with care, magic mushroom chocolate can remain potent and safe. But when left exposed, it can lose its power or worse, become unsafe to consume. Knowing the signs keeps the experience clean and intentional.
Look, Smell, Taste — Then Trust Your Gut
Your senses are your first line of defense. If something feels off, it usually is. Trust the subtle cues.
Visual signs like mold growth, extreme blooming, or a crumbly, dry texture suggest spoilage. If your chocolate looks distorted or discolored, it may have absorbed moisture or been exposed to heat.
Smell matters too. Sour, musty, or rotten scents indicate degradation. If your bar smells like spoiled dairy or damp earth, it is time to let it go.
Taste is your final filter. A metallic, dull, or bitter flavor that feels out of place is a clear sign to pause. When in doubt, do not ingest.
Potency Loss Warning Signs
Sometimes the bar looks fine. It even smells and tastes right. But the experience feels off. If your dose feels inconsistent, flat, or unpredictable, the issue could be degraded psilocybin. Potency begins to fade after three months when left at room temperature, and drops further over time.

What About Dried Mushrooms? Sacred Storage Matters Here, Too
Chocolate is just one vehicle. Many seekers still walk with the raw mushroom, dried and whole. This form carries its own frequency and potency, but only if stored with the same reverence. These fungi are sacred. They must be protected like the medicine they are.
Optimal Conditions for Dried Mushrooms
The mantra here is simple. Cool. Dark. Dry.
Store dried mushrooms in an environment between 60 and 70 degrees Fahrenheit. Keep humidity below 50 percent to prevent mold from forming.
Light breaks down the active compounds, so use opaque or amber glass jars to block UV rays. Respecting these conditions preserves both strength and spirit.
Storage Containers That Work
Not all containers are created equal. Airtight mason jars combined with desiccant packs create a powerful barrier against moisture.
For long-term preservation, vacuum-sealed bags offer a reliable path. Avoid plastic ziplocks. They trap humidity and slowly break down the mushroom’s integrity over time.
When Dried Mushrooms Go Bad
Your senses will tell you. If you see any mold, discard them immediately. No dose is worth the risk. If the texture becomes rubbery or bendy, moisture has crept in and altered the structure.
A faded color or a weak, stale smell may point to alkaloid breakdown. When the life force fades, so does the medicine.
